Speed implies we will have less time to help ourselves and is the cause of fast heartbeats and adrenalin pumping through our veins. Whereas slow and shambolic Zombies are slow burning creeping creatures that, as Barbera says in 1990NOTLD, you could walk right through them.
Personally they both freak me out but the one's who could catch me are scarier. Romero is genius because in his films the zombies are more of an afterthought. Take Dawn where whole moments of non-Z happenings happen until Peter drops his tennis ball and we are reminded THEY are still out there. The are neither protagonists or antagonists - they are the background. The antagonists are the bikers who don't care for the living or the dead. In modern fast zombie movies it is the zombies who ARE the enemy and therefore need to have something Romero zombies didn't - speed. ROTLD had fast Zombies too, in fact a bunch of them chase a guy at full speed, yet nobody ever complains about it.
